Run over by a train ( or three)
The underside view of three passing trains. The first is the French built Xtrapolis followed by one of the few remaining Hitachis and then a Comeng set.

224 cars and six units power off in to evenings failing light.
A Dash 8, two SD70's, 112 cars, another Dash 8 and a pair of SD40's followed by another 112 cars. I have edited it down. Shot in failing light at the end of my day trackside at this location.
